Description: Are you curious about the differences between Christianity and Mormonism? While both religions claim to follow Jesus Christ, there are significant and often overlooked distinctions between their beliefs and practices.  This comprehensive essay explores the origins, doctrines, and controversies surrounding the Mormon faith, comparing and contrasting them with traditional Christian teachings. Through careful research and analysis, the author examines the historical claims, theological concepts, and religious practices that set Mormonism apart from mainstream Christianity.

From the life of Joseph Smith and the authenticity of the Book of Mormon to the unique doctrines of eternal progression and celestial marriage, this essay provides a thorough and thought-provoking look at the complex world of Mormonism. It also delves into the challenges faced by the LDS community, including issues of historical accuracy, archaeological evidence, and the problem of suicide among Mormon youth.
